Output 8a436c1fc57ac1dd39cdf981508a5aa11d40abbcb6cceeb1c22efd0187f3cc73:1

value
3373965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3135f8ae268c5e211c808d2e97d5625ae0bf9b5 OP_EQUAL
address
3Lw5i6RqarKT33jw3hbYnMjLZNHBfzoBcj
transaction
8a436c1fc57ac1dd39cdf981508a5aa11d40abbcb6cceeb1c22efd0187f3cc73
confirmations
114480
spent
true